The Medical Assistant will perform a variety of clinical, documentation, professional, safety, and clerical support duties within a multispecialty clinic setting. The position requires a commitment to providing exceptional patient care, maintaining accurate records, and adhering to all safety and infection control protocols. Requirements

  • High School Diploma/GED or equivalent OR 2 years of work experience.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ification from American Heart Association.
  • Knowledge of general medical terminology, hospital policies and procedures, and Joint Commission and HIPAA regulations.
  • Ability to obtain and maintain accurate patient medical records.
  • Basic computer and data entry skills in MS Office applications (Word, Excel and Power Point).
  • Analytical skills to determine job priorities, multi-task and work independently.

Responsibilities

  • Measures and records vital signs, identifying abnormal values and reporting findings to nursing staff or medical provider.
  • Assists with patient arrival, schedules appointments, and facilitates patient exit from the clinic.
  • Recognizes and responds to emergencies according to organizational policy.
  • Provides for patient comfort needs, considering age and special needs.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of clinic equipment, including preparation, safety testing, cleaning, and disinfection.
  • Maintains linens, supplies, and equipment, and stocks exam rooms.
  • Collects, prepares, and secures laboratory specimens for testing and transport.
  • Documents appropriately in the patient medical record according to departmental guidelines.
  • Navigates the Electronic Medical Record to obtain results, outside records, update demographics, and schedule appointments.
  • Prepares safety reports as directed by the Clinic Manager.
  • Maintains patient privacy by securing computer screens when unattended.
  • Demonstrates honesty, promptness, dependability, courtesy, and respect in all interactions.
  • Consults with and informs the clinic manager of clinic activities, requirements, and problems.
  • Manages patient and co-worker complaints calmly and positively, reporting events to the clinic manager.
  • Maintains strict patient confidentiality.
  • Implements standard and transmission-based precautions.
  • Ensures patient safety during clinic visits.
  • Reports safety hazards or violations to the Clinic Manager.
  • Actively participates in Quality Improvement Process, including QAPI projects and EOC Rounds.
  • Gathers appropriate clinical documentation for provider review.
  • Obtains medical records from outside facilities.
  • Scans outside correspondence into the electronic medical record.
  • Answers the telephone and routes calls promptly.
